首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在IFrame中加载本地主机站点时出现问题

可能是由于浏览器的安全策略导致的。浏览器为了防止恶意网站通过IFrame加载本地站点进行攻击,通常会限制IFrame只能加载同源(同协议、同域名、同端口)的内容。

解决这个问题的方法有以下几种:

  1. 使用相对路径:将IFrame中的src属性设置为相对路径,而不是直接使用本地主机的绝对路径。这样可以避免跨域的问题。
  2. 配置CORS(跨域资源共享):如果你有权限修改本地主机站点的服务器配置,可以在服务器端设置CORS头部,允许其他域名的访问。具体的配置方法可以参考相关服务器的文档。
  3. 使用代理服务器:可以在本地主机站点和加载该站点的页面之间设置一个代理服务器,将IFrame的src属性指向代理服务器的地址。代理服务器可以将请求转发到本地主机,并在响应中添加CORS头部,解决跨域问题。
  4. 使用反向代理:如果你有一个公网服务器,可以将本地主机站点通过反向代理的方式暴露在公网上,然后在IFrame中加载公网服务器的地址。这样就不会存在跨域问题了。

总结起来,解决在IFrame中加载本地主机站点时出现问题的方法主要有使用相对路径、配置CORS、使用代理服务器或反向代理。具体选择哪种方法取决于你的具体需求和环境。腾讯云提供了一系列云计算产品,如云服务器、云数据库、云存储等,可以帮助你构建和部署应用。你可以访问腾讯云官网(https://cloud.tencent.com/)了解更多相关产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

互联网直播点播平台进行iframe直播分享如何禁止本地视频自动播放?

我们的视频直播点播流媒体服务器可以做集成和二次开发的,也可以将直播分享到其他页面,操作比较便捷。 ?...那就有客户提了,说想要进行iframe直播分享嵌入到其他页面,但是不想要视频自动播放,想要关闭这个视频自动播放的功能。 ?...系统设置的过程iframe生成video 标签,会自动加上autoplay属性,这个属性就是自动播放的意思,加上这个属性之后视频会自动播放。...我们的研发人员通过代码默认不开启、指定src源等操作发现并不奏效,最后通过 src 属性的最后面加上 &autoplay=no ,页面加载完毕后,把这个属性设置掉,就成功解决自动播放问题。 ?

77950
  • 盗窃网络域名_域名实际上是与计算机什么对应的

    页面加载,如果仅仅是加载一个index.html页面,那么该页面里面只有文本,最终浏览器只能呈现一个文本页面。丰富的多媒体信息无法站点上面展现。...而A站点,希望自己的网站上面也展示这些图片,直接使用: 这样,大量的客户端访问A站点,实际上消耗了B站点的流量,而A站点却从中达成商业目的...HTTP协议和标准的浏览器对于解决这个问题提供便利,浏览器加载非本站的资源,会增加一个头域,头域名字固定为:Referer 而在直接粘贴地址到浏览器地址栏访问,请求的是本站的该url的页面,是不会有这个...一般的站点或者静态资源托管站点都提供防盗链的设置,也就是让服务端识别指定的Referer,服务端接收到请求,通过匹配referer头域与配置,对于指定放行,对于其他referer视为盗链。...,加载过来的脚本如果有定义的函数或者接口,可以本地使用,这也是我们用得最多的脚本加载方式。

    2K20

    使用浏览器作为代理从公网攻击内网

    可疑行为:公网到局域网的连接 从恶意站点加载的 JavaScript 可以许多情况下能够连接用户本地计算机(localhost)或其他内部主机上运行的服务。...进行威胁建模,开发者通常认为本地服务永远不会接收外部输入,因此通常缺乏对这些服务的安全审核。...然而,本文中,我们的重点将是进行侦察以及通过跨站点请求伪造(CSRF)利用时从 JavaScript 错误推断信息。...互联网上,我们可能会找到现成的默认文件列表,以便在进行指纹识别查找 [19] [20]。 在上一节,我们验证了哪些猜测的主机确实存在。...攻击本地运行的 Jenkins 展示如何通过绕过步骤浏览 targetorg.com 的内网,让我们回到通过公网攻击内网服务的任务

    1.2K10

    https引入http资源资源所导致的问题

    虽然这样让http升级为https,但是导致出现的问题是,之前加载http资源的图片显示不了, 样式,js加载不了, 写在本地还行,但如果是公共的js文件,往往就是存在cdn或者其他服务器上, 这时候如果访问不了...当一个页面出现这种情况, 他被称为混合内容页面. 浏览器访问https页面,如果该htpps页面中有一些http资源,我们可以把这些http资源,叫做混合内容(Mixed Content)。...浏览器出现以上混合内容显示的问题,是因为https协议请求的站点,读取的资源文件js、css、图片、音视频,甚至包括请求post和get,还有iframe的页面,都必须是https协议的。...等带有http的资源换成https方式,但要注意,有些外部http资源,如果没有https方式,直接换成https就会出现问题,最好还是下载到本地来实现!...h5办法 . h5方法,使用js自己加载协议情况,如在body onload='aa()', aa() 方法,将资源按照需求加载进来即可。

    4.5K82

    觅道文档 v0.5.9 发布,性能提升+双编辑器加持……

    ; 新增文集目录定位跳转,长目录下当前文档的目录显示目录最顶端; 新增后台配置允许上传的附件格式和附件大小; 新增后台配置允许上传的图片大小; EditorMD编辑器模式下优化文档页面JS加载,按需加载各类...之前的版本,音视频只支持特定后缀文件格式 URL 链接,而 iframe 的视频也是只支持部分主流站点的 URL 链接。 对于很多企业内部用户来说,使用静态存储或本地内网链接反而更常见。... v0.5.9 版本,则带来了图片文件大小的自定义配置,附件文件大小和文件格式的自定义配置。这样可以让用户更加灵活地配置自己的觅道文档站点。 ?...组件按需加载 优化了EditorMD编辑器模式下,文档页面思维导图、流程图、时序图、数学公式、Echarts图表等组件JS文件的加载。当文档无上述内容,则不加载其JS文件。...最后 “记录文档、汇聚思想”,觅道文档一次又一次更新变得更加好用。接下来的更新,还将会带来: 时间线; 文集转让; 本地上传音视频; 个人文集备份导出; 站点备份导出;

    79121

    绕过混合内容警告 - 安全的页面加载不安全的内容

    这是很有道理的:许多网站使用 HTTP 协议从外部加载它们的图像,或更糟的情况,它们资源硬编码了指向本地图像的 HTTP 协议,但内容本身(html/scripts)是安全的。...有件有趣的事要记住,两个浏览器都认为伪协议(res: mhtml: file:)是不安全的,所以如果我们尝试使用这些协议加载内容,都会失败,就像普通 http https 那样。...这些奇怪的协议被使用者用来加载硬盘的文件来检测本地文件的存在,如果主页是安全的,他们将有一个大问题:IE 将拒绝解析这些协议。因此不要使用他们的技巧!...之前我们知道了没有用户交互的情况下渲染内容的规则(image 标签)存在着例外情况,我尝试加载源是图像的 IFRAME (而不是 IMG),但并没有成功。...当不安全的 bing.com 试图渲染另一个不安全的 iframe 内部内容,问题发生了。换句话说,iframe 的子元素也需要是安全的或者绕过这点,相同的技巧也需要重定向。

    3.1K70

    前端性能优化-雅虎军规35条

    ,而问题在于脚本阻止了页面的平行下载,即便是主机名不相同 8、避免使用CSS表达式 页面显示和缩放,滚动、乃至移动鼠标,CSS表达式的计算频率是我们要关注的。...url小于2K使用GET获取数据更加有意义。 18、延迟加载 确定页面运行正常后,再加载脚本来实现如拖放和动画,或者是隐藏部分的内容以及折叠内容等。...19、预加载 关注下无条件加载,有条件加载和有预期的加载。 20、减少DOM元素个数 使用更适合或者语意是更贴切的标签,要考虑大量DOM元素循环的性能开销。...21、根据域名划分页面内容 很显然, 是最大限度地实现平行下载 22、尽量减少iframe的个数 考虑即使内容为空,加载也需要时间,会阻止页面加载,没有语意,注意iframe相对于其他DOM元素高出1-...由于是同一台服务器上,它每被请求一次coockie就会被发送一次。这个图片文件还会影响下载顺序,例如在IE当你 onload请求额外的文件,favicon会在这些额外内容被加载前下载。

    1.2K50

    早早聊 C7 笔记 - 【字节】时光:微前端沙盒体系的落地实践

    sandbox Deployment Splitting # 沙盒应该做什么 古老的 iframe —— 古老的困难 一些能做的 一个站点页面拆成 N 个 frame 每个 frame 单独一个独立域名...独立上下线 独立运行时 困难 难以 deeplinking 数据共用困难 登录身份 站内信 跨模块通信 困难重重的共用代码、加载优化、运行优化 # 沙盒像什么 Docker 开发者必须体会不到环境的区别...通过对事件循环封装,模拟单核多进程 用 Context 切换模拟线程安全 新沙盒即将激活,查找当前激活的沙盒 保存现场,存储 Context 恢复之前的 Context Context 切换的笛卡尔积...比较并切换 沙盒数量 N 的笛卡尔平方 退回“初始” Context 恢复之前 diff 的 Context # 字节的沙盒做了什么 # CSS 的干扰 独立开发、混合加载 HTML 标准的...、系统采样的设计 # 埋点数据的缓存创建 全局数据(uid 等)默认缓存本地 缓存跟随沙盒切换 两级缓存 沙箱内全局 系统全局 # 埋点数据的发送 异步发送 触发时机沙盒外、缓存跟随沙盒切换 全局缓存和本地缓存统一本地存储

    30520

    「面试常问」靠这几个浏览器安全知识顺利拿到了大厂offer(实践篇)

    它是指黑客往 HTML 文件或者 DOM 中注入恶意脚本,从而在用户浏览页面利用注入的恶意脚本对用户实施攻击的一种手段。...CSRF Token」 大概过程是可以分成 2 步骤: 浏览器向服务器发起请求,服务器生成一个 CSRF Token。...往往是攻击者将目标网站通过 iframe 嵌入到自己的网页,通过 opacity 等手段设置 iframe 为透明的,使得肉眼不可见,这样一来当用户攻击者的网站操作的时候,比如点击某个按钮(这个按钮的顶层其实是...frame busting 如果 A 页面通过 iframe 被嵌入到 B 页面,那么 A 页面内部window 对象将指向 iframe,而 top 将指向最顶层的网页这里是 B。...点击劫持的本质就是通过视觉来欺骗用户,顺着这个思路,还有一个攻击方法也和这个类似,那就是「图片覆盖攻击」大概的原理就是通过样式把图片覆盖攻击者所希望的任意位置,比如盖一个网站的 logo 上,当用户点击图片的时候就会被链接到攻击者的站点

    85420

    《黑客攻防技术宝典:浏览器实战篇》-- 上篇(笔记)

    1.1.10 Web 存储 Web 存储有两种存储机制:一种可以将数据持久保存在本地,另一种只会话期间保存数据。...3)操作历史:使用历史对象,脚本可以添加或删除位置,也可以历史链向前或向后移动当前页面。...6)X-Frame-Options 用于阻止浏览器的页面内嵌框架,浏览器看到这个首部后,不把接收到的页面显示一个 IFrame ,目的是防止发生界面伪装(UI Redressing)攻击,如点击劫持...1.2.4 反网络钓鱼和反恶意软件 浏览器会在访问网站,将其与恶意站点名单进行对照,如果检测到要访问的网站是一个钓鱼网站,浏览器就会采取措施。...2)静默更新 如果浏览器在后台更新和新增功能出现问题,就可能增大每个浏览器的攻击面。 3)扩展 每个扩展都可能成为攻击者的目标,因而它们会增大浏览器的攻击面。

    63010

    js跨域解决方案

    一、问题描述 页面渲染需要动态获取iframe子页面的高度,然后重新设置iframe高度,达到自适应的目的,但是由于iframe子页面也涉及到访问其他系统的页面,这就使得页面渲染无法获取子页面高度...跨域问题是由于javascript语言安全限制的同源策略造成的. 简单来说,同源策略是指一段脚本只能读取来自同一来源的窗口和文档的属性,这里的同一来源指的是主机名、协议和端口号的组合....aa.xx.com,bb.xx.com这种特点,也就是两个页面必须属于一个基础域(例如都是xxx.com,或是xxx.com.cn),使用同一协议(例如都是 http)和同一端口(例如都是80),这样两个页面同时添加...网上有很多例子,很容易找到,不过该解决方案存在一些问题: a 安全性,当一个站点(b.a.com)被攻击后,另一个站点(c.a.com)会引起安全漏洞 b如果一个页面引入多个iframe,要想能够操作所有...js文件,然后通过本页面就可以调用加载后js文件的函数,这样做的缺陷就是不能加载其它域的文档,只能是js文件,jsonp便是通过这种方式实现的,jsonp通过向其它域传入一个callback参数,通过其他域的后台将

    4K10

    Kali Linux Web渗透测试手册(第二版) - 4.8- 执行跨站点请求伪造攻击

    虽然这证明了这一点,但外部站点(或本例本地HTML页面)可以应用程序上执行密码更改请求。用户仍然不太可能点击“提交”按钮。 我们可以自动执行该操作并隐藏输入字段,以便隐藏恶意内容。...我们的文件看起来像这样: 注意表单的target属性是如何在它下面定义的iframe,并且这样的框架具有0%的高度和宽度。 10.启动会话的浏览器中加载新页面。...这个截图显示了使用浏览器的开发人员工具检查页面的外观: ? 请注意,iframe对象页面只是一个黑线,Inspector,我们可以看到它包含BodgeIt用户的配置文件页面。 11....当我们应用程序中有活动会话的同一浏览器中加载页面,即使它是不同的选项卡或窗口,并且此页面向启动会话的域发出请求,浏览器将自动附加会话该请求的cookie。...我们还使用隐藏的iframe加载密码更改的响应,因此,受害者永远不会看到他/她的密码已更改的消息。

    2.1K20

    关于 Cookie,了解这些就足够了

    图片:Unsplash ✔ Cookie 是什么 cookie Cookie 是用户浏览器保存在本地的一小块数据,它会在浏览器下次向同一服务器再发起请求被携带并发送到服务器上。...✔ Path Path 标识指定了主机下的哪些路径可以接受 Cookie(该 URL 路径必须存在于请求 URL )。以字符 %x2F (/) 作为路径分隔符,子路径也会被匹配。...,如图片加载或者 iframe 不会发送,而点击 标签会发送; 请求类型 示例 正常情况 Lax 链接 发送 Cookie 不发送 iframe 发送 Cookie 不发送 AJAX $.get("...")...Session 能够存取任何类型的数据; 服务器压力不同,Session 是存储服务端的,巨大并发的时候会使服务器资源急速飙升。Cookie 则不存在此问题

    1.8K20

    前端面试题1(HTML篇)

    兼容模式,页面以宽松的向后兼容的方式显示,模拟老式浏览器的行为以防止站点无法工作 HTML5 为什么只需要写 ?...link属于XHTML标签,除了加载CSS外,还能用于定义RSS,定义rel连接属性等作用;而@import是CSS提供的,只能用于加载CSS 页面被加载,link会同时被加载,而@import引用的...在用户没有与因特网连接,可以正常访问站点或应用,在用户与因特网连接,更新用户机器上的缓存文件 原理:HTML5的离线存储是基于一个新建的.appcache文件的缓存机制(不是存储技术),通过这个文件上的解析清单离线存储资源...之后当网络处于离线状态下,浏览器会通过被离线存储的数据进行页面展示 如何使用: 页面头部像下面一样加入一个manifest的属性; cache.manifest文件的编写离线存储的资源 离线状态...cookie是网站为了标示用户身份而储存在用户本地终端(Client Side)上的数据(通常经过加密) cookie数据始终同源的http请求携带(即使不需要),记会在浏览器和服务器间来回传递

    1.8K10
    领券